The art department is bursting with creativity in every corner! Art 8 students are getting messy with paper mâché, creating larger than life sculptures just like Pop artist Claes Oldenburg. Studio Art classes are getting inspired and creating artwork influenced by the Masters who’ve come before them. Sculpture students are getting precise by measuring, cutting, and folding their way to paper sculpture success. And Painting students are getting matchy by recreating the colors they see in order to replicate a masterpiece. We even have some seniors working on a brand new mural outside the library – more on that to come!

Our ELA students have been busy!

Sophomores are sharpening their grammar skills with the board game In Pursuit of Grammar—because learning is always better with a little friendly competition. Seventh graders are getting creative using the “We Will Write” software to bring their ideas to life. Our AP Language & Composition students are hard at work perfecting their argumentative free response essays—future debate champions in the making. 8th graders are kicking off their newest adventure with a Choose Your Own Adventure book study—where every choice leads somewhere new. And 11th Grade Regents students are diving into the powerful and inspiring Tuesdays With Morrie. We are so proud of all the hard work happening in our classrooms!

¡Hola! College-level Spanish students have been busy researching and presenting on opportunities for ecotourism throughout Mexico and Central America... With a little help from Pre-K Future Spanish Star Karson! Students and friends came to watch the presentations and we're all feeling ready for our own Spanish Club ecotourism adventure in less than two months to Costa Rica. I'll be travelling with 18 students to explore the volcanos, rainforests, cloud forests, hot springs, beaches, and all the incredible culture that Costa Rica has to offer. It will be the trip of a lifetime ¡Pura vida!

Our science classes have been buzzing with excitement! In Integrated Science, students have been wrapping up their Environmental Science and Groundwater units, while Earth and Space Science students have been diving into geologic hazards like earthquakes and volcanoes. Before break, our science students also had an amazing opportunity to attend a STEM Day event sponsored by Corning Community College and the Career Development Council. It was a great experience filled with learning, exploration, and inspiration!
